Development of Dusting Prevention Stabilizer for Stainless Steel Slag

Akira Seki, Yoshio Aso, Makoto Okubo, Fumio Sudo, Kunihiko Ishizaka
Synopsis :
Stainless steel slag with a basicity of over 1.5 pulverized into fine particles during cooling in the past. Such pulverization was liable to cause environmental problems and disturbed further utilization of slag. To solve such problems, a stabilizing agent has been developed which can prevent pulverization of the slag with only 0.5% addition. Borate is used as a stabilizer, and the content of its crystal water is adjusted to obtain more homogeneous diffusion and resolution in molten slag. Best result is achieved for K-BOP slag at 7% crystal water content, and the stabilized stainless steel slag after 3 months aging period becomes equivalent to blast furnace slag in its quality, thereby making it applicable to aggregate for road construction.
